Yeah that sounds about right. The Build Up is usually what sets people off. 33-37 degrees with humidity at 80% or higher without any rain. Then the Wet Season does get occasional relief due to the thunderstorms.

Those temperatures are why we won't do Daylight Savings. Our workdays start early in the morning. My hubby starts between 6.30 - 7am. I work in government and we start at 8am.
